Starting from the integration of Amazon Seller Fulfilled Prime (SFP) within NetSuite, qualified sellers can directly fulfill Prime orders using their own shipping operations. The NetSuite Connector seamlessly processes SFP orders through a familiar framework used for Merchant Fulfilled Network (MFN) orders, simplifying the management of shipping labels and order fulfillment.

How Does the Amazon SFP Add-On Work?

The Amazon SFP add-on enables users to automate the purchasing of shipping labels from Amazon directly within NetSuite. This process eliminates manual steps and ensures that the cheapest valid shipping option is selected. Here’s a detailed workflow:

  1. Order Retrieval: NetSuite Connector retrieves an SFP order from Amazon.

  2. Label Preparation: The Connector fetches available shipping services based on the order’s shipping locations and costs.

  3. Label Purchase: Upon selection, the Connector purchases a shipping label from Amazon using the identified shipping service ID. The result includes essential shipment data such as shipment ID, tracking number, and a printable shipping label.

  4. Label Processing: The obtained shipping label is processed and synced to a custom field within the sales order in NetSuite.

  5. Final Steps in NetSuite: After syncing the order and label:

    • Access the sales order in NetSuite.
    • Print the shipping label from the designated File Cabinet folder.
    • Ship the item.
    • Mark the order as fulfilled.

Important Considerations

  • The integration requires an additional fee for setup and ongoing operations.
  • The process diverges if the shipping label is printed via Amazon instead of NetSuite. In such cases, once the shipment is processed, the order is marked as completed/shipped in Amazon, meaning no further sync of fulfillment data is necessary.
